## The Unexpected Joy of Learning to Code as an Adult 💻✨
For years, coding was something I relegated to those “tech-savvy” kids and ambitious college students. It seemed intimidating, complicated, and frankly, not my cup of tea. But then, something shifted. Maybe it was the increasing digitalization of our world, or perhaps a spark of curiosity ignited within me. Regardless, I found myself drawn to the idea of learning to code – even as an adult.
**Shattering Assumptions:**
My first assumption? It would be incredibly hard. While there’s no denying coding requires dedication and practice, it’s also surprisingly accessible. With countless online resources, interactive platforms, and supportive communities, the learning curve feels less daunting than I imagined.
**Discovering a New World of Creativity:**
Coding isn’t just about lines of text; it’s about building things! From simple websites to interactive games, you can create something tangible with code. This creative outlet has been incredibly fulfilling – a welcome change from the often-stultifying routines of adult life.
**Unlocking Problem-Solving Skills:**
Coding is all about breaking down complex problems into smaller, manageable steps. This process has inadvertently sharpened my problem-solving skills in all areas of my life. Suddenly, that tangled mess of wires or frustrating software glitch seems less insurmountable.
**Building a Community of Support:**
The coding community is surprisingly welcoming. Online forums, local meetups, and even virtual hackathons offer opportunities to connect with fellow learners and experienced developers. This sense of shared purpose and collaboration has been truly invaluable.
**Empowering Myself in a Digital World:**
Learning to code isn’t just about technical skills; it’s about understanding the world we live in. In a digital age, basic coding knowledge empowers you to navigate the internet more effectively, understand the workings of technology, and even advocate for yourself as a consumer.
